The persistence of a two-child family ideal in Europe

How persistent and universal has the two child family ideal been in Europe during the last three decades?

Fuente: Tomáš Sobotka and Éva Beaujouan - Population and Development

The mean ideal family size has become closely clustered around 2.2 in most countries and none of the analyzed surveys suggests a decline in mean ideal family size to levels considerably below replacement.
